My daughter is studying photography and I am fairly new to digital. We wanted a camera with a significant range of manual and low light options as well as the usual bells and whistles. We haven't managed to find fault with this one yet. All the functions are clearly indicated and easy to find. The optics are easily good enough for a digital camera within reasonable limits - for instance I wouldn't expect fabulous definition at extreme zoom range but I do expect and get it between 35mm and 300mm equivalents. The price is exceptionally good for the quality. Only tiny niggle - no facility for remote shutter release - useful for low light tripod work - but you could set the timer I suppose.
